Output 85eb885a394c9367b3412090d2320f8fc4462b7c42a28815cb8a83a715e8ac03:1

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a29d81155430b7834176733f75bb6a48e2627bf OP_EQUAL
address
345McuQns7FKNr3UkUtTxdHg4M9WiT7VHW
transaction
85eb885a394c9367b3412090d2320f8fc4462b7c42a28815cb8a83a715e8ac03
spent
true